Good question, I liked my regular DAC2 and the 10th takes it up several notches. In fact I'm a huge fan of the brand in general, I've got the DAC, a Recovery, a Reclocker and their linear PSU (can't recall the name) all in my system right now. I agree w/one review that mentions the 10th can be a bit too resolving when it comes to poorly mastered discs, but that isn't really a fault of the product. It's just reproducing what's on the CD. As mentioned in another post the service from the company is beyond excellent. I wouldn't hesitate to recommend any of the products I've mentioned.

IMHO, Wyred is a truly great company.

I'm contemplating a system upgrade soon, and also thinking of getting the Anniversary. Currently using a DAC2DSDSE with femto clock and I like it so much that I haven't been motivated to upgrade. I did own a Bricasti M1 as well as a Berkeley Alpha2 for a time, which were both very nice, but I've now sold both because the DAC2SDSE was ultimately the most enjoyable in my system. (It's amazing that the DAC2DSDSE can compete with DAC's 4x the price)

Part of my upgrade will involve bi-amping the speakers, and for wooofers I'll be ordering a pair of SX1000R's.
